Summary

Even before the partition of India and Pakistan, the Indus posed problems between the states of British India. The problem became international only after partition, though, and the attendant increased hostility and lack of supra-legal authority only exacerbated the issue. Pakistani territory, which had relied on Indus water for centuries, now found the water sources originating in another country, one with whom geopolitical relations were increasing in hostility. Numerous treaties and agreements were proposed from 1947 through 1960, yet none were able to transform the conflict, and arguments continued up until the Indus Water Agreement of 1960. The Indus Water Treaty was signed in Karachi on September 19, 1960 and government ratifications were exchanged in Delhi in January 1961. The Indus Water Treaty was developed by the World Bank and addressed both the technical and financial concerns of each side, and included a timeline for transition. The treaty also established the Permanent Indus Commission, made up of one Commissioner of Indus Waters from each country. The question over the flow of the Indus is a classic case of the conflicting claims of up- and down-stream riparians. Since 1960, no projects have been submitted under the provisions for "future cooperation," nor have any issues of water quality been submitted at all. Other disputes have arisen, and been handled in a variety of ways. One controversy surrounding the design and construction of the Salal Dam was resolved through bilateral negotiations between the two governments. Other disputes, over new hydroelectric projects and the Wuller Barrage on the Jhelum tributary and the Baglihar dam on the Chenab River in Kashmir, have yet to be resolved. Pakistan has indicated that it might seek World Bank arbitration if the matter is not sorted out through bilateral talks.
